Agile Analog Collaborates with Xiphera for Post-Quantum Cryptography Challenge
AI-summarised brief · reviewed before publication
Agile Analog, an analog security IP specialist, has partnered with Xiphera, a hardware-based cryptographic solutions expert, to create a unified defense solution for the next generation of semiconductor security. The collaboration integrates Agile Analog's anti-tamper sensor IP and Xiphera's digital cryptographic IP cores, addressing the industry's transition to Post-Quantum Cryptography (PQC). The combined solution provides a comprehensive defense against both digital and physical threats, safeguarding semiconductor designs against future quantum threats and physical attacks.
